MEETING OF COUNTY COUNCIL

Monday, March 13, 2006

QUESTION No. 26

QUESTION: Cllr. Fintan McCarthy

To ask the Manager to detail the number of ongoing unresolved planning enforcement cases with which the Council is dealing? 

REPLY

There are 701 active enforcement cases at present. Upon receipt of a written complaint alleging an unauthorized development, the Planning Enforcement Section examines the complaint. The length of time taken for resolution of an unauthorized development varies from case to case. The normal procedure is service of a Warning Letter, followed by the service of an Enforcement Notice. The developer has a right to apply for retention of the development. However, enforcement proceedings are not stayed by virtue of such application.

Of the 701 current cases;

54 are with the Council’s Solicitor for prosecution through the Courts

74 Enforcement Notices have been served recently

102 Warning Letters have issued following investigation and submissions are awaited

471 are under investigation (in some of these cases submissions received in response to Warning Letters served are currently under consideration)
